Design of Medical Devices Conference, China 2018

Schwegman is proud to support the University of Minnesota and sponsor the 2018 Design of Medical Devices Conference in Beijing, China (December 10-12). The conference aims to strengthen the cooperation between the academic world and industry, facilitate medical device-related policies, and research/education at the University of Minnesota and around the world.

With the theme of “international exchanges and technological innovation”, the DMD Conference will focus on policy interpretations on China and international medical devices, hot directions of medical devices, medical devices training, technology release of advanced medical technology projects, connection of projects, and an exhibition section. The conference attracts world-class designers, research scholars, approving authorities, manufacturers, healthcare organizations and public management departments in the medical device field.

Representing Schwegman will be Principal patent attorney, Doug Portnow.  Doug is teaming up with Executive Vice President and patent attorney Dr. Deshan Li of Unitalen Attorneys at Law to present on IP law pertaining to medical devices and how to build an IP portfolio while managing a budget, enforcement, and due diligence.
